Scott John High (born 15 February 2001) is a professional footballer who plays as a midfielder for EFL League One club Huddersfield Town. Born in England, High has represented Scotland at under-21 level.
Born in Dewsbury, [3] High began his career with Huddersfield Town. He moved on loan to Concord Rangers in November 2019 until January 2020, [4] but was recalled by Huddersfield a month later. [5] He returned to Concord Rangers in February 2020 for a second loan spell. [5] [6]
High made his senior debut for Huddersfield on 22 July 2020, the last day of the 2019–20 season. [3] On 3 August 2020, he joined League One side Shrewsbury Town on loan for the 2020–21 season. [7] He scored his first senior career goal on 4 September 2020, netting for Shrewsbury in a 4–3 away defeat to Middlesbrough in an EFL Cup match. [8] On 29 December 2020 it was announced that his loan deal had ended. [9] He joined Rotherham United on a season-long loan on 29 July 2022. [10] However, his loan was terminated on 11 January 2023. [11]
In September 2023 he signed on loan for Scottish club Ross County. [12] On 8 January 2024, High returned to Huddersfield following a lack of playing time. [13]
On 4 February 2024, High was loaned to League of Ireland Premier Division club Dundalk until the summer. [14]
High was first named in the Scotland under-21 squad in August 2021. [15] As of August 2022, he had made seven appearances without scoring. [16] [17]
